“I don’t think the technology in and of itself is a problem; it’s the attempt at using the technology to replace teaching. Teaching should replace teaching.” – mollishka on http://spheroid.wordpress.com/2007/01/22/technology-teaching-teal-part-1-mits-hotshot-innovation/#comment-9

“Teachers make PowerPoints and think we’re so excited to see them but it’s just like writing on the blackboard.” (high school girl 2006)  “And then they read them to us.  Why should I have to go to hear it read? (another student 2006)”  from Emerging Technologies for Learning 2007.
